let adjust_log_level s =
let ts =
List.map
(fst Mirage_runtime.Arg.log_threshold)
(String.split_on_char ',' s)
in
let* oks =
List.fold_left (fun acc t ->
let* acc = acc in
match t with
| `Ok l -> Ok (l :: acc)
| `Error msg -> Error msg)
(Ok []) ts
in
Ok (Mirage_runtime.set_level
~default:(Option.value (Logs.level ()) ~default:Logs.Info)
oks)
let enable_of_str s =
let s = String.lowercase_ascii s in
if s = "enable" || s = "on" then
Ok `Enable
else if s = "disable" || s = "off" then
Ok `Disable
else
Error ("couldn't decode 'enable' or 'disable': " ^ s)
let adjust_metrics s =
let ts =
List.map (fun s ->
match String.split_on_char ':' s with
| [ en ] | [ "*" ; en ] ->
let* en_or_d = enable_of_str en in
Ok (`All, en_or_d)
| [ src ; en ] ->
let* en_or_d = enable_of_str en in
Ok (`Src src, en_or_d)
| [ "src" ; src ; en ] ->
let* en_or_d = enable_of_str en in
Ok (`Src src, en_or_d)
| [ "tag" ; src ; en ] ->
let* en_or_d = enable_of_str en in
Ok (`Tag src, en_or_d)
| _ -> Error ("couldn't decode metrics " ^ s))
(String.split_on_char ',' s)
in
let* (all, tags, srcs) =
List.fold_left (fun acc t ->
let* (all, tags, srcs) = acc in
let* t = t in
match t with
| `All, en_or_d -> Ok (Some en_or_d, tags, srcs)
| `Src s, en_or_d -> Ok (all, tags, (s, en_or_d) :: srcs)
| `Tag t, en_or_d -> Ok (all, (t, en_or_d) :: tags, srcs))
(Ok (None, [], [])) ts
in
(match all with
| Some `Enable -> Metrics.enable_all ()
| Some `Disable -> Metrics.disable_all ()
| None -> ());
List.iter
(function
| t, `Enable -> Metrics.enable_tag t
| t, `Disable -> Metrics.disable_tag t)
tags ;
List.iter (fun (src, e_or_d) ->
match List.find_opt (fun s -> Metrics.Src.name s = src) (Metrics.Src.list ()), e_or_d with
| Some src, `Enable -> Metrics.Src.enable src
| Some src, `Disable -> Metrics.Src.disable src
| None, _ ->
Log.warn (fun m -> m "%s is not a valid metrics source." src))
srcs ;
Ok ()
